This is an automated email from the ASF dual-hosted git repository.
ishan pushed a change to branch jira/SOLR15694
in repository https://gitbox.apache.org/repos/asf/solr.git.
discard 23fa655 Review feedback
omit 40ce412 Adding changelog and sonatype fixes
omit cdb4467 Fixing precommit
omit b885de3 cleanup and more test assertions
omit 1328ae1 addressed review comments
omit 457f848 Addressing review feedback
omit 8a37db9 rearranged API paths
omit 31fff12 Fix typo in reg guide
omit 92d3621 Ref guide fixes
omit 43022e5 Fixing precommit
omit a14085a Adding Roles API to ref guide
omit 173b130 removed unnecessary changes
omit e37399d removed unnecessary changes
omit be6efc2 removed unnecessary changes
omit 21f198c removed nocommit
omit deb9fc6 clanup
omit 2a9ffff SOLR-15694: Ref guide changes
omit 1af10d4 supportedroles and overseer:disallowed supported
omit 3a82fcf Adding defaultIfAbsent, minor formatting fixes
omit d3ae808 new format
omit 0603772 unused import
omit 5954fb1 refactor
omit f0fca8f Multiple roles supported per node
omit 1309a25 tests were failing intermittently
omit c98ee0f added test
omit e65b46c added APIs
omit 557ae9c use a separate node
omit 5f4a9ec suppress warnings
omit 79c0741 cleanup
omit ccad574 license header
omit c69a564 Node role impl
add 1217f48 SOLR-15871: Upgrade to Log4j 2.17.1 (#489)
add ba44a16 SOLR-14608: Update CHANGES.txt
add 1059f2d SOLR-15890: Add a limit to the Admin SQL panel if one is not
included in the stmt
add 7ffd3ad SOLR-15890: Make more robust
add c73bcdc SOLR-15890: Update CHANGES.txt
add 02b7590 SOLR-15845 SolrVersion class only recording current version,
and based on SemVer (#472)
add de35baa SOLR-15756 Add back contrib readmes in distribution (#492)
add f843282 Simplify rm statement, make sure deletion works, remove
redundant solr-core jar (#494)
add e4f11c3 SOLR-15876 Update to error-prone 2.10 (#477)
add 80936d1 SOLR-14279: remove CSVStrategy's deprecated setters (#480)
add f6c1db6 SOLR-15896 Fix the toString method of SolrVersion (#500)
add bc1d92b add example of using wildcard on fl parameter (#483)
add d38a954 SOLR-15887: Remove <jmx/> from shipped solrconfig.xml (#485)
add ef81651 Add next major version 10.0.0
add eff7d49 SOLR-15862 Remove reference to LUCENE_CHANGES.txt going
forward
add a793d13 SOLR-15876: Fix errror prone on JDK 16 or later (disable).
This reverts parts of #477
add 985f3a7 SOLR-15862 Use lucene baseVersion 9.0.0 for property
tests.luceneMatchVersion instead of Solr version
new dda7676 Node role impl
new c560810 license header
new 36457fb cleanup
new f1c559b suppress warnings
new 1697395 use a separate node
new 259f44c added APIs
new bbac7c9 added test
new 9c2ac73 tests were failing intermittently
new 674475a Multiple roles supported per node
new ba9301d refactor
new fada885 unused import
new 9cdc7bf new format
new 81e45d8 Adding defaultIfAbsent, minor formatting fixes
new 93330f0 supportedroles and overseer:disallowed supported
new 25db5fc SOLR-15694: Ref guide changes
new 6da69e1 clanup
new 12d782f removed nocommit
new 2e37319 removed unnecessary changes
new 636e3dc removed unnecessary changes
new 4fb6b33 removed unnecessary changes
new 52651a3 Adding Roles API to ref guide
new 7756206 Fixing precommit
new ec0a013 Ref guide fixes
new bbabe91 Fix typo in reg guide
new 64b7777 rearranged API paths
new 7deb91d Addressing review feedback
new 0017f0b addressed review comments
new 2e6fd12 cleanup and more test assertions
new 53aa03d Fixing precommit
new 81385af Adding changelog and sonatype fixes
new 0ac0b32 Review feedback
new c0f1fdc Fixing precommit
new b80ad84 Fixing precommit
new 9518cdc Fixing precommit
This update added new revisions after undoing existing revisions.
That is to say, some revisions that were in the old version of the
branch are not in the new version. This situation occurs
when a user --force pushes a change and generates a repository
containing something like this:
* -- * -- B -- O -- O -- O (23fa655)
\
N -- N -- N refs/heads/jira/SOLR15694 (9518cdc)
You should already have received notification emails for all of the O
revisions, and so the following emails describe only the N revisions
from the common base, B.
Any revisions marked "omit" are not gone; other references still
refer to them. Any revisions marked "discard" are gone forever.
The 34 revisions listed above as "new" are entirely new to this
repository and will be described in separate emails. The revisions
listed as "add" were already present in the repository and have only
been added to this reference.
Summary of changes:
build.gradle | 4 +-
dev-tools/scripts/README.md | 9 +-
dev-tools/scripts/addVersion.py | 130 +++++------------
dev-tools/scripts/scriptutil.py | 14 +-
gradle/solr/packaging.gradle | 2 +-
gradle/testing/randomization.gradle | 4 +-
gradle/validation/error-prone.gradle | 2 +-
solr/CHANGES.txt | 37 ++++-
solr/bin/post | 2 +-
.../src/java/org/apache/solr/core/NodeRoles.java | 8 +-
.../java/org/apache/solr/handler/ClusterAPI.java | 4 -
.../solr/handler/component/FacetComponent.java | 4 +-
.../apache/solr/handler/loader/CSVLoaderBase.java | 24 ++--
.../org/apache/solr/internal/csv/CSVParser.java | 2 +-
.../org/apache/solr/internal/csv/CSVStrategy.java | 157 ++-------------------
.../apache/solr/packagemanager/PackageManager.java | 13 +-
.../apache/solr/packagemanager/PackageUtils.java | 8 --
.../solr/packagemanager/RepositoryManager.java | 3 -
.../apache/solr/response/CSVResponseWriter.java | 66 +++++----
.../apache/solr/servlet/CoreContainerProvider.java | 4 +-
.../processor/UUIDUpdateProcessorFactory.java | 2 +-
.../src/java/org/apache/solr/util/SolrCLI.java | 3 +-
.../src/java/org/apache/solr/util/SolrVersion.java | 151 ++++++++++++++++++++
.../apache/solr/cloud/TestRandomFlRTGCloud.java | 8 +-
.../apache/solr/internal/csv/CSVParserTest.java | 13 +-
.../apache/solr/internal/csv/CSVStrategyTest.java | 27 ++--
.../test/org/apache/solr/util/TestSolrVersion.java | 65 +++++++++
solr/docker/templates/Dockerfile.body.template | 2 +-
.../error_prone_annotations-2.10.0.jar.sha1 | 1 +
.../error_prone_annotations-2.9.0.jar.sha1 | 1 -
solr/licenses/log4j-1.2-api-2.17.0.jar.sha1 | 1 -
solr/licenses/log4j-1.2-api-2.17.1.jar.sha1 | 1 +
solr/licenses/log4j-api-2.17.0.jar.sha1 | 1 -
solr/licenses/log4j-api-2.17.1.jar.sha1 | 1 +
solr/licenses/log4j-core-2.17.0.jar.sha1 | 1 -
solr/licenses/log4j-core-2.17.1.jar.sha1 | 1 +
.../log4j-layout-template-json-2.17.0.jar.sha1 | 1 -
.../log4j-layout-template-json-2.17.1.jar.sha1 | 1 +
solr/licenses/log4j-slf4j-impl-2.17.0.jar.sha1 | 1 -
solr/licenses/log4j-slf4j-impl-2.17.1.jar.sha1 | 1 +
solr/licenses/log4j-web-2.17.0.jar.sha1 | 1 -
solr/licenses/log4j-web-2.17.1.jar.sha1 | 1 +
.../solr/configsets/_default/conf/solrconfig.xml | 19 ---
.../conf/solrconfig.xml | 19 ---
solr/server/solr/solr.xml | 10 +-
.../src/common-query-parameters.adoc | 4 +
.../java/org/apache/solr/cloud/ZkTestServer.java | 32 +----
solr/webapp/web/js/angular/controllers/sqlquery.js | 9 +-
versions.lock | 10 +-
versions.props | 4 +-
50 files changed, 451 insertions(+), 438 deletions(-)
create mode 100644 solr/core/src/java/org/apache/solr/util/SolrVersion.java
create mode 100644 solr/core/src/test/org/apache/solr/util/TestSolrVersion.java
create mode 100644 solr/licenses/error_prone_annotations-2.10.0.jar.sha1
delete mode 100644 solr/licenses/error_prone_annotations-2.9.0.jar.sha1
delete mode 100644 solr/licenses/log4j-1.2-api-2.17.0.jar.sha1
create mode 100644 solr/licenses/log4j-1.2-api-2.17.1.jar.sha1
delete mode 100644 solr/licenses/log4j-api-2.17.0.jar.sha1
create mode 100644 solr/licenses/log4j-api-2.17.1.jar.sha1
delete mode 100644 solr/licenses/log4j-core-2.17.0.jar.sha1
create mode 100644 solr/licenses/log4j-core-2.17.1.jar.sha1
delete mode 100644 solr/licenses/log4j-layout-template-json-2.17.0.jar.sha1
create mode 100644 solr/licenses/log4j-layout-template-json-2.17.1.jar.sha1
delete mode 100644 solr/licenses/log4j-slf4j-impl-2.17.0.jar.sha1
create mode 100644 solr/licenses/log4j-slf4j-impl-2.17.1.jar.sha1
delete mode 100644 solr/licenses/log4j-web-2.17.0.jar.sha1
create mode 100644 solr/licenses/log4j-web-2.17.1.jar.sha1